Stablecoin Bill Shakes Washington

Innovation Stifled or Security Strengthened?

The GENIUS Act, aimed at establishing a regulatory framework for stablecoins in the U.S., is facing political headwinds.

Nine Democratic senators—who initially supported it—have withdrawn their backing, citing concerns related to national security and anti-money laundering.

Key Takeaways: The bill mandates that stablecoin issuers hold 100% reserves, excluding algorithmic stablecoins and those issued by non-U.S. entities like Tether.

Banks could benefit from easier access to the stablecoin market, while innovative non-bank players might face greater challenges.
